  • @MotorcycleExtremist
    @MotorcycleExtremist Před 10 lety +1

    This is one of the bikes I've been considering for my next purchase. The other 2 bikes at the top of my list are the Tiger 800 and the new Suzuki V-Strom 1000. Planed use is a mix of commuting and touring. It seems that either of these bikes will do all I want, and price is not a deciding factor for me. I'd assume the Ninja Z1000SX would be more fun of the three when it's time to play. Do you have any recommendations on why I might consider one of these over the other?

    • @FreEntity
      @FreEntity Před 10 lety +1

      Check my channel for some touring vids of the Z1000SX.
      It's not a real touring bike ... as it will not give you the full comfort of a real touring bike, but it is much more sporty :)
      I was loaded with 2 full paniers, topcase & 2 bags on the rear seat, 50kg total, travelled 7000km through Europe, only 300km highway, the rest corner after corner after corner ... at Sunday twisties fun speeds ... and I wouldn't know a better bike to do that stuff. To give an idea about the sportiveness of the road trip ...
      First set of tires PP3 = 2500 km & fully up, second set of tires PR3 = 3400 km & fully up,
      This is a torque monster, with a lot of usable power. Put a 190/55 rear tire on it & the turn in is improved a lot. Put some professional suspension on it (Bitubo) & you have a bike that can hold a supersport in the twisties.
